Output 40a3e91bc4efd4310191e0fe81797ae6774e22e914ae6d3b4ceb22b0ed295dc7:51

value
24095060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e500c174f617a8bb280f35c7955d3ac4dc742e88 OP_EQUAL
address
3NZsZykST9R4ymg1AR7T7UZNKxrKhD8jEc
transaction
40a3e91bc4efd4310191e0fe81797ae6774e22e914ae6d3b4ceb22b0ed295dc7
spent
true